Why the cbc with differential may be ordered for Carpal Tunnel Syndrome
Measures red blood cells, white blood cells, and platelets to help evaluate overall health and detect disorders such as anemia, infection, and leukemia.
When evaluating Carpal Tunnel Syndrome, a healthcare provider may order the cbc with differential alongside other tests based on your symptoms, history, and physical exam. Test selection and result interpretation are clinical decisions made by a qualified professional.
